在使用Mac电脑进行web开发或者自动化测试时,可能会遇到无法打开Chromedriver的问题,这种情况可能会让你无法正常使用Chrome浏览器,影响你的工作效率,以下是一些可能的原因以及相应的解决方法。

问题原因

  1. Chromedriver版本与Chrome浏览器版本不匹配,Chromedriver需要与Chrome浏览器的版本相对应,如果版本不匹配,则无法打开Chromedriver。
  2. 权限问题,在某些情况下,Mac系统可能会阻止对Chromedriver的访问,导致无法打开。
  3. 路径问题,如果Chromedriver的路径没有正确设置,也会导致无法打开。

解决方法

  1. 检查并更新Chromedriver和Chrome浏览器版本,确保两者版本相匹配,如果不匹配,请下载相应版本的Chromedriver。
  2. 更改文件权限,尝试更改Chromedriver的权限,以便Mac系统可以访问,可以通过在终端中使用chmod命令来更改文件权限,使用命令“chmod 775 chromedriver”来更改文件权限。
  3. 检查并设置Chromedriver路径,确保Chromedriver的路径已经添加到系统的环境变量中,以便系统可以正确找到并运行它,如果没有设置路径,可以在系统偏好设置中的“其他”选项中添加Chromedriver路径。
  4. 重新安装Chromedriver,如果以上方法都无法解决问题,可以尝试重新安装Chromedriver,在下载新的Chromedriver版本时,确保下载适用于Mac的版本。

解决Mac上无法打开Chromedriver的问题

操作步骤

  1. 检查Chromedriver和Chrome版本:在Chrome浏览器和Chromedriver的官方网站上查看版本信息,并下载相应的版本。
  2. 更改文件权限:在终端中使用chmod命令更改Chromedriver文件权限。
  3. 设置Chromedriver路径:在系统偏好设置中添加Chromedriver路径到环境变量中。
  4. 重新安装Chromedriver:在下载新的Chromedriver版本时,确保下载适用于Mac的版本,并按照安装向导进行安装。

通过以上方法,你应该能够解决Mac上无法打开Chromedriver的问题,如果问题仍然存在,请检查你的防火墙设置或者联系Chromedriver的技术支持获取更多帮助。